Taylor Swift has once again sent her fans into a frenzy with a double surprise. Not only has she announced a new album is on the way, but she has also unveiled the track list for the highly anticipated release.

During her acceptance speech for Best Pop Album at the Grammy Awards, Swift shared a secret she had been keeping for the past two years. “My brand new album comes out on April 19,” she revealed, expressing her gratitude to fans for their support.

Shortly after her announcement, the cover art for “The Tortured Poets Department” appeared on Swift’s social media platforms. The haunting image left fans eagerly anticipating what was to come.

Now, we have a glimpse into the musical journey that awaits us. Swift took to Twitter to share the track list, and it’s filled with intriguing titles and exciting collaborations. One song features none other than Post Malone, while another showcases the talents of Florence and the Machine.

Here is the full track list for “The Tortured Poets Department”:

  • “Fortnight” featuring Post Malone
  • “The Tortured Poets Department”
  • “My Boy Only Breaks His Favorite Toys”
  • “Down Bad”
  • “So Long, London”
  • “But Daddy I Love Him”
  • “Fresh Out The Slammer”
  • “Florida!!!” featuring Florence and the Machine
  • “Guilty as Sin?”
  • “Who’s Afraid of Little Old Me?”
  • “I Can Fix Him (No Really I Can)”
  • “LOML”
  • “I Can Do It With A Broken Heart”
  • “The Smallest Man Who Ever Lived”
  • “The Alchemy”
  • “Clara Bow”
  • Bonus track: “The Manuscript”
